How to Download, Install & Activate QuickBooks Desktop 2024 (Complete Step-by-Step Guide)

Whether you’ve just purchased a QuickBooks Desktop 2024 license or are upgrading from an older version, this guide walks you through the entire process โ€” from downloading the installer to entering your license key and activating the software.

This guide covers QuickBooks Desktop Pro 2024, Premier 2024, and Enterprise 24.0 on Windows. The installation process is identical for all three editions.

๐Ÿ’ก Don’t have a license yet? If you need to purchase a genuine QuickBooks Desktop 2024 license without a subscription, LicenseRetail sells official surplus licenses at below-retail prices with instant email delivery: Pro 2024 ยท Premier 2024 ยท Enterprise 2024

Step 1 โ€” Check System Requirements Before Installing

Before downloading, confirm your computer meets the minimum requirements. Installing on an unsupported system causes activation failures and performance issues.

ComponentMinimum RequirementRecommended
Operating SystemWindows 10 (64-bit, natively installed)Windows 11 (64-bit)
Processor2.4 GHz Intel or AMD x863.0 GHz+ quad-core
RAM8 GB16 GB
Disk Space2.5 GB for installationSSD + extra space for company file
Screen Resolution1280 ร— 10241920 ร— 1080 or higher
InternetRequired for activation onlyNot needed for daily use
โš ๏ธ Important: Microsoft ends Windows 10 support in October 2025. Intuit strongly recommends Windows 11 for QuickBooks Desktop 2024 to ensure full compatibility and security updates going forward. ARM-based processors (such as Microsoft Surface Pro X) are not supported.

Step 2 โ€” Download the QuickBooks Desktop 2024 Installer

You have two ways to get the installer:

Option A โ€” Download from Intuit directly (recommended)

  1. Go to downloads.quickbooks.com/app/qbdt/products
  2. Select your product: Pro 2024, Premier 2024, or Enterprise 24.0
  3. Select your country: United States
  4. Click Download โ€” the file is approximately 600 MBโ€“1 GB
  5. Save the installer file to your Desktop or Downloads folder

Option B โ€” Use the download link from your purchase email

If you purchased from LicenseRetail, your purchase confirmation email includes a direct Intuit download link for your specific edition. Click that link to download the exact installer you need.

๐Ÿ’ก Tip: Make sure you download the correct edition. Pro, Premier, and Enterprise have separate installers. Downloading the wrong one and entering your license key will cause an activation error.

Step 3 โ€” Run the Installer

  1. Locate the downloaded file (named something like QuickBooksDesktopPro2024.exe) and double-click it to run
  2. If Windows asks “Do you want to allow this app to make changes?” โ€” click Yes
  3. The QuickBooks Installation wizard will open. Click Next to begin
  4. Read and accept the License Agreement โ†’ click Next
  5. Enter your License Number and Product Number from your purchase email โ†’ click Next
  6. Choose installation type:
    • โ†’Express (recommended) โ€” installs in the default location. Best for most users.
    • โ†’Custom and Network Options โ€” for multi-user setups or server installations.
  7. Click Install โ€” installation takes approximately 5โ€“15 minutes depending on your computer speed
  8. When complete, click Open QuickBooks
โš ๏ธ Before installing: Temporarily disable your antivirus during installation. Some antivirus programs (especially Windows Defender) incorrectly flag QuickBooks installer files. Re-enable it immediately after installation is complete.

Step 4 โ€” Activate QuickBooks Desktop 2024

After installation, QuickBooks opens in trial mode. You need to activate it with your license key to unlock full functionality.

Online activation (recommended โ€” fastest)

  1. Open QuickBooks Desktop 2024
  2. Go to Help โ†’ Activate QuickBooks Desktop
  3. Follow the on-screen prompts โ€” QuickBooks connects to Intuit’s servers to verify your license
  4. Enter your license number and product number when prompted
  5. Click Activate โ€” activation typically completes in under 60 seconds
  6. You’ll see a “Congratulations โ€” QuickBooks has been activated” confirmation screen

Phone activation (if online activation fails)

  1. In the activation window, click “Activate by Phone”
  2. QuickBooks displays an Installation Key Number (IKN)
  3. Call Intuit’s activation line: 1-800-316-1052
  4. Provide your license number, product number, and IKN to the automated system
  5. You’ll receive a Confirmation Number โ€” enter it in QuickBooks to complete activation
โœ… Activation successful? You’ll see your company name and registered user details in Help โ†’ About QuickBooks. If activation succeeds, QuickBooks is fully unlocked and ready to use โ€” no internet required for day-to-day accounting.

Step 5 โ€” Set Up Your Company File

After activation, QuickBooks will ask you to open or create a company file. This is where all your accounting data is stored.

Creating a new company file

  1. Select “Create a new company” on the welcome screen
  2. Choose “Express Start” (recommended for new users) or “Detailed Start” for full customization
  3. Enter your company name, industry type, and fiscal year start
  4. Choose where to save your company file โ€” we recommend a dedicated folder like C:\QBCompanyFiles\
  5. Click Create Company File

Restoring an existing company file

  1. Select “Open or restore an existing company”
  2. Browse to your existing .QBW company file or backup .QBB file
  3. If upgrading from an older version, QuickBooks will prompt you to update the file format โ€” click Yes (this is a one-way conversion, so back up first)
๐Ÿ’ก Back up immediately: After setting up your company file, go to File โ†’ Back Up Company โ†’ Create Local Backup. Store your backup on an external drive or cloud storage. Do this daily once you start entering data.

Troubleshooting Common Installation Errors

If you run into issues during installation or activation, here are the most common errors and how to fix them:

  • Error: “The license number or product number is invalid”
    Make sure you’re entering the license number and product number for the correct edition (Pro, Premier, or Enterprise). Double-check for typos โ€” O vs 0 and I vs 1 are common mistakes. If you purchased from LicenseRetail and the key still fails, contact our support immediately for a replacement.
  • Error: “QuickBooks installation has failed”
    Temporarily disable your antivirus, restart your computer, and run the installer again as Administrator (right-click โ†’ “Run as administrator”). Also ensure you have at least 3 GB of free disk space.
  • Error: “QuickBooks is already registered to another user”
    This indicates the license was not properly deregistered by the previous owner. Contact LicenseRetail support โ€” we will resolve this with a replacement key under our Activation Guarantee.
  • Error: “Cannot connect to QuickBooks licensing server”
    Temporarily disable your firewall and try again. If using Windows Defender Firewall, add QuickBooks as an exception. Alternatively, use phone activation (Step 4 above) which doesn’t require internet.
  • Error: “QuickBooks is not compatible with this version of Windows”
    QuickBooks Desktop 2024 requires 64-bit Windows 10 or 11 natively installed. It does not run on 32-bit Windows or ARM processors. Check: Settings โ†’ System โ†’ About to confirm your Windows version.

๐Ÿ”’ Purchased from LicenseRetail and having activation issues?


Installing QuickBooks Desktop for Multiple Users (Network Setup)

If you have a multi-user license (Premier supports up to 5 users, Enterprise up to 40), you can share a single company file across your office network.

Basic multi-user setup

  1. Install QuickBooks on the server computer (the machine that will host the company file). During installation, choose “Custom and Network Options”
  2. Select “I’ll be using QuickBooks on this computer, AND I’ll be storing our company file here so it can be shared over our network”
  3. Install QuickBooks on each workstation (other computers). Choose “I will NOT be storing our company file on this computer”
  4. On the server, go to File โ†’ Utilities โ†’ Host Multi-User Access
  5. On workstations, open QuickBooks โ†’ File โ†’ Open or Restore Company โ†’ browse to the server’s company file via the network path
๐Ÿ’ก For Enterprise users: Enterprise supports Windows Server 2016/2019/2022 as the host machine. Running QuickBooks on a dedicated server gives the best multi-user performance and stability for 5+ users.

Need a QuickBooks Desktop 2024 License?

If you followed this guide and need a genuine QuickBooks Desktop 2024 license โ€” no subscription, no monthly fees โ€” LicenseRetail stocks official surplus licenses at below-retail prices with instant email delivery.

Buy a genuine QuickBooks Desktop 2024 license โ€” no subscription

Official surplus licenses. Instant email delivery. Activation guaranteed or replaced free.

Pro 2024 โ€” $199 Premier 2024 โ€” $249 Enterprise 2024 โ€” $399

Frequently Asked Questions

Where can I download QuickBooks Desktop 2024?
Download QuickBooks Desktop 2024 directly from Intuit at downloads.quickbooks.com/app/qbdt/products. Select your edition (Pro, Premier, or Enterprise), select United States, and click Download. If you purchased from LicenseRetail, your confirmation email also includes a direct download link.
What Windows version does QuickBooks Desktop 2024 require?
QuickBooks Desktop 2024 requires 64-bit Windows 10 or Windows 11, natively installed. It does not support 32-bit Windows or ARM processors. Windows 11 is strongly recommended since Microsoft ends Windows 10 support in October 2025.
How long does QuickBooks Desktop 2024 installation take?
Installation typically takes 5โ€“15 minutes depending on your computer speed and internet connection. Downloading the installer (approximately 600 MBโ€“1 GB) takes additional time depending on your internet speed.
Can I install QuickBooks Desktop on multiple computers?
Yes, but the number of simultaneous users depends on your license. Pro 2024 supports up to 3 simultaneous users, Premier supports up to 5, and Enterprise supports up to 40. You can install the software on multiple computers but the user limit applies to how many can access the company file at the same time.
What if my license key doesn’t activate?
First, try phone activation by calling Intuit at 1-800-316-1052. If the key is invalid or already registered, and you purchased from LicenseRetail, contact our support immediately โ€” every license is covered by our Activation Guarantee and we will replace it at no cost.
Does QuickBooks Desktop 2024 require internet after installation?
No. After activation, QuickBooks Desktop 2024 runs completely offline for all core accounting functions โ€” invoicing, expense tracking, reporting, payroll preparation, and more. Internet is only needed for optional features like live bank feeds and downloading software updates.
Can I upgrade from an older version of QuickBooks Desktop?
Yes. QuickBooks Desktop 2024 can open and automatically upgrade company files from QuickBooks Desktop 2021, 2022, and 2023. For versions older than 2021, the upgrade process may require an intermediate step. Always back up your company file before upgrading.
How do I find my QuickBooks license number after installation?
In QuickBooks Desktop, go to Help โ†’ About QuickBooks. Your license number and product number are displayed on this screen. You can also find them in your original purchase confirmation email from LicenseRetail.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top